The Pillars Fund (Pillars) is a nonprofit grantmaking organization whose mission is to amplify the leadership, voices, and talents of Muslims in the United States. Since its founding in 2010, Pillars has distributed more than $6 million in grants to Muslim organizations and leaders to advance its mission. In an effort to change inaccurate and incomplete narratives about Muslims in the United States, four years ago Pillars also began investing in Muslim artists and storytellers and engaging media and entertainment industry leaders to promote more accurate and nuanced stories about Muslims for broad mainstream distribution. This grant provides flexible support for Pillars’ storytelling and narrative change work, including efforts to build the storytelling capacity of its network of grassroots grantee organizations and to recast inaccurate and misleading characterizations of Muslims in American media and popular culture.

Since its founding in 2010, the Pillars Fund has been a leading voice for the American Muslim community. Initially created as a donor advised giving circle, Pillars has grown into a leading philanthropic and advocacy organization that ensures American Muslim stories and voices are seen and heard. This grant supports Pillars to design and implement a series of storytelling and culture change activities that amplify the voices of Muslim-Americans, challenge narrative tropes that misrepresent the Muslim American experience, and build up a cadre of professional storytellers committed to creating content for mass audiences that accurately depicts the full range of lived experiences and perspectives of Muslims in the United States. These activities are designed to engage the millions of American Muslims across the country in storytelling efforts designed to push back against negative stereotypes and recast public narratives and perceptions about their contributions to American society.

Grant funds are being used to launch a new initiative at Pillars designed to equip members of its diverse community to tell their own stories, lift up a range of perspectives within Muslim-American communities across the country, and shed light on often under-represented or misunderstood issues related to the Muslim- American experience. MacArthur support is helping to move Pillars beyond its initial scope of providing funding to community-based organizations to become a go-to source for information and expertise about Muslim Americans. The initiative’s goal is to engage the millions of American Muslims across the country in media making efforts designed to push back against negative stereotypes and recast public narratives and perceptions about their contributions to American society and democracy.
